Monday is fact day, so here are this weeks facts you may or maynot know already.


The most populated city in the world, when major urban areas are included is Tokyo....


Swedish confectionery salesman Roland Ohisson was buried in a coffin made of chocolate in 1973


Mercedes Benz cars are named after a girl called Mercedes Jellinek

Coca Cola and Dr Pepper were both introduced in the same year 1886


One weird wedding present received by Queen Victoria was a giant wheel of Cheddar Cheese it weighed over 1,000 pounds.
